Output 5895602744bf5d214ce359f5cb5720b32f87effb6b97ec7cd3ac1df3307327b5:6

value
58313352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b46b3806e05dd4290e2be4a09b0d352380e254 OP_EQUAL
address
3MMZLWMZFtxHm6YyzmHSrbbzvMUCR8eNXn
transaction
5895602744bf5d214ce359f5cb5720b32f87effb6b97ec7cd3ac1df3307327b5
spent
true